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– महाभूतानि सृष्ट्वाथ तद गुणान निर्ममे पुनः

Shloka (श्लोक)
महाभूतानि सृष्ट्वाथ तद गुणान निर्ममे पुनः
भूतेभ्यश चैव निष्पन्ना मूर्तिमन्तॊ ऽसतताञ शृणु
⚡ Quick Meaning
The great elements were created along with their qualities.
Translations
English Translation
Having created the Mahābhūta, the five great elements, the Lord also fashioned their attributes. These entities, becoming manifest, are called “forms” and they encompass the characteristics and qualities associated with these elements, vital for understanding nature’s interplay.

Commentary
Context
This shloka continues the discourse on the elemental basis of all life, emphasizing the relationship between elements and their inherent qualities.
Meaning
The essence of elements is not only in their existence but also in the qualities they possess, which shape the experiences of all beings.
Application
By understanding both the elements and their qualities, one can navigate through life more consciously and harmoniously, promoting balance in interactions with the world.
